A maker of rechargeable car batteries that was using a $118.5 million Energy Department grant to build a factory in Indiana fil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ection Thursday, becoming the latest green-energy company backed by the Obama administration to run into trouble.
Ener1 Inc., the latest culprit of Obama’s crash-and-burn program, claims that it will stay afloat through the bankruptcy proceedings due in large part to “$81 million in new funds, mostly from Bzinfin S.A., a company backed by Russian businessman Boris Zingarevich.”
The bankruptcy filing is the latest embarrassment for the clean-energy program included in President Barack Obama’s 2009 economic-stimulus package. Last September, Solyndra LLC, a California solar-panel maker, declared bankruptcy and shut down, leaving taxpayers with losses on the $527 million in government loans the company had received. A smaller company that was developing electric-grid technology with U.S. support also filed for bankruptcy protection last fall.
